What is Harrison ALPHA1350S?

The Harrison ALPHA1350S is a CNC lathe that operates with high precision and efficiency, widely utilized in industries such as aerospace, automotive, and general manufacturing. It processes materials like steel, aluminum, and plastic, thanks to its advanced turning capabilities. The machine integrates cutting-edge CNC technology to execute intricate cutting tasks, ensuring high-quality results with minimal manual intervention.

Harrison ALPHA1350S specifications and capacity size and travels

SpecificationsInchesMM
Max Swing Over Bed21 inches533 mm
Max Cutting Length60 inches1524 mm
Spindle Bore3.1 inches78 mm
